Comprehending Key Types

Before diving into the replacement procedure for a Ford Kuga, let's very first check out the types of keys available for this model.

Key TypeDescriptionFeatures
Standard KeyBasic metal blade key without electronic devicesBasic style, simple to cut
Transponder KeyMetal key with embedded chipProvides extra security, needs programming
Key FobRemote key with buttons for locking/unlockingTypically includes a key blade for physical gain access to
Smart KeyKeyless entry and push-to-start performanceAllows chauffeur to begin the car without physical insertion

1. Examine the Situation

Identify whether you have lost your key, or if it's merely harmed. This can impact how you continue with the replacement. If the key is damaged but still partly functional, think about going to a locksmith professional or dealership for repair work.

2. Determine the Key Type

Determine which type of key you have. The Ford Kuga might utilize a standard key, transponder key, key fob, or smart key depending on the design year.

3. Collect Details

Before looking for a replacement, gather the vehicle's details:

  • Vehicle Identification Number (VIN)
  • Proof of ownership (registration, title, or insurance coverage)
  • Identification (driver's license or government-issued ID)

4. Choose Your Replacement Option

There are numerous avenues to acquire a replacement key, each with varying expenses:

Replacement OptionDescriptionApproximated Cost Range
Ford DealershipThe best choice, though it typically comes at a premium₤ 250 - ₤ 500
Regional LocksmithMay offer competitive rates and can configure keys₤ 100 - ₤ 300
Online RetailersPurchase blank keys or fobs, often require a locksmith for programming₤ 20 - ₤ 150
DIY Programming KitsThese packages often include directions for self-programming₤ 50 - ₤ 200

5. Location Your Order

After choosing the most appropriate option, location your order. If you're selecting a car dealership, it is a good idea to call ahead to guarantee they have your needed part in stock.

6. Programming the Key

Remember that more recent models of the Ford Kuga frequently need programming to sync the key with your car's security system. This can be done by either a car dealership or a qualified locksmith professional.

7. Test Your Key

Once you get your key or have it made, test it to ensure it works properly. Verify that you can unlock/lock the doors, as well as start the vehicle.

Approximated Costs of Key Replacement

Key replacement expenses can differ commonly depending upon the type of vehicle key, origin of replacement, and place. Below is an average variety based upon the choices gone over:

Key TypeReplacement MethodTypical Cost Range
Traditional KeyRegional locksmith₤ 50 - ₤ 100
Transponder KeyFord Kuga Car Key Replacement Dealership₤ 200 - ₤ 300
Key FobLocksmith or Online₤ 100 - ₤ 250
Smart KeyDealer only₤ 300 - ₤ 500

FAQ Section

Q1: Can I get a replacement key if I lost all keys for my Ford Kuga?

Yes, it is possible to acquire a Replacement Car Keys Ford even if you do not have a spare. A locksmith or dealership can develop a new key by utilizing your vehicle recognition number (VIN).

Q2: How long does the key replacement process take?

The time it requires to replace a key varies by method. A dealership might take a few hours to a complete day, while a locksmith professional may provide quicker service-- typically within an hour.

Q3: Can I set a new key myself?

If you have a blank key and access to the right programming package, you might have the ability to configure it in your home. Nevertheless, this isn't recommended unless you are comfortable with the procedure, as incorrect programming can result in more problems.
